1// SPDX-License-Identifier: GPL-2.0-only
2/*
3 * 32-bit test to check vDSO mremap.
4 *
5 * Copyright (c) 2016 Dmitry Safonov
6 * Suggested-by: Andrew Lutomirski
7 */
8/*
9 * Can be built statically:
10 * gcc -Os -Wall -static -m32 test_mremap_vdso.c
11 */
12#define _GNU_SOURCE
13#include <stdio.h>
14#include <errno.h>
15#include <unistd.h>
16#include <string.h>
17
18#include <sys/mman.h>
19#include <sys/auxv.h>
20#include <sys/syscall.h>
21#include <sys/wait.h>
22
23#define PAGE_SIZE	4096
24
25static int try_to_remap(void *vdso_addr, unsigned long size)
26{
27	void *dest_addr, *new_addr;
28
29	/* Searching for memory location where to remap */
30	dest_addr = mmap(0, size, PROT_NONE, MAP_PRIVATE|MAP_ANONYMOUS, -1, 0);
31	if (dest_addr == MAP_FAILED) {
32		printf("[WARN]\tmmap failed (%d): %m\n", errno);
33		return 0;
34	}
35
36	printf("[NOTE]\tMoving vDSO: [%p, %#lx] -> [%p, %#lx]\n",
37		vdso_addr, (unsigned long)vdso_addr + size,
38		dest_addr, (unsigned long)dest_addr + size);
39	fflush(stdout);
40
41	new_addr = mremap(vdso_addr, size, size,
42			MREMAP_FIXED|MREMAP_MAYMOVE, dest_addr);
43	if ((unsigned long)new_addr == (unsigned long)-1) {
44		munmap(dest_addr, size);
45		if (errno == EINVAL) {
46			printf("[NOTE]\tvDSO partial move failed, will try with bigger size\n");
47			return -1; /* Retry with larger */
48		}
49		printf("[FAIL]\tmremap failed (%d): %m\n", errno);
50		return 1;
51	}
52
53	return 0;
54
55}
56
57int main(int argc, char **argv, char **envp)
58{
59	pid_t child;
60
61	child = fork();
62	if (child == -1) {
63		printf("[WARN]\tfailed to fork (%d): %m\n", errno);
64		return 1;
65	}
66
67	if (child == 0) {
68		unsigned long vdso_size = PAGE_SIZE;
69		unsigned long auxval;
70		int ret = -1;
71
72		auxval = getauxval(AT_SYSINFO_EHDR);
73		printf("\tAT_SYSINFO_EHDR is %#lx\n", auxval);
74		if (!auxval || auxval == -ENOENT) {
75			printf("[WARN]\tgetauxval failed\n");
76			return 0;
77		}
78
79		/* Simpler than parsing ELF header */
80		while (ret < 0) {
81			ret = try_to_remap((void *)auxval, vdso_size);
82			vdso_size += PAGE_SIZE;
83		}
84
85#ifdef __i386__
86		/* Glibc is likely to explode now - exit with raw syscall */
87		asm volatile ("int $0x80" : : "a" (__NR_exit), "b" (!!ret));
88#else /* __x86_64__ */
89		syscall(SYS_exit, ret);
90#endif
91	} else {
92		int status;
93
94		if (waitpid(child, &status, 0) != child ||
95			!WIFEXITED(status)) {
96			printf("[FAIL]\tmremap() of the vDSO does not work on this kernel!\n");
97			return 1;
98		} else if (WEXITSTATUS(status) != 0) {
99			printf("[FAIL]\tChild failed with %d\n",
100					WEXITSTATUS(status));
101			return 1;
102		}
103		printf("[OK]\n");
104	}
105
106	return 0;
107}
